Davao Crocodile Park

Just like Puerto Princesa in Palawan, Davao City has its own Crocodile Park. Located near the Riverfront, Davao Crocodile Park is just 20-30 minutes away from the city center. The park is an ideal place for group tours as well as educational tours. Travelers who enjoys wildlife will surely love this theme park.

The park is also a center known for conserving crocodiles and other animal species. In addition to crocodiles, this park also has other species such as monkeys, snakes, birds and various other types of reptiles. One of the unique things you can find inside the park is modern crocodile farming system. The park is also one among the few places in the Philippines where visitors can enjoy the flora and fauna of Davao City.

Davao Crocodile Park is run and managed by a group of businessmen under the leadership of Mr. Sonny Dizon. The park was opened to the public in August 18th, 2006. The park is the abode of Pangil, the second largest crocodile in the country. Pangil means “fangs” and this reptile measures about 18 feet long.

This park also offers special shows every day between 4pm to 4.30pm.  Davao Crocodile Park is mainly constructed with concrete pens and wire screen that is welded with the help of double security doors. Visitors can find walk pathways and benches for a comfortable tour through the park. Toilets and other basic amenities are also provided for visitors in the park.

The park has a food and souvenir shop too. It is located at the exit area of the park. Visitors can also buy crocodile leather products such as leather wallets and bags etc. The skeleton of Dugong is also a major attraction of this park.

Crocodile eggs are hatched within an incubation room that is present inside the park but is restricted to public. There are also two yearling pens. Feeding a full grown crocodile is also a rare view you will get inside the park. The park also has three breeding ponds. Visitors can have a safer view of the crocodiles standing from a bridge. There is also a special area in the park that is designed for the dog training.

How to get there

The Davao Crocodile Park is located near the Riverfront Hotel at the Riverfront, Corporate City Diversion Highway, Ma-a, Davao City. There is an entrance fee of Php100 for adults and Php50 for kids. Tourists and locals will need a vehicle to reach it.
